Creating Successful Dating Apps with Modern Templates

Learn how online dating app templates accelerate development with modern features, user-friendly design, and monetization strategies for success.

The online dating industry has experienced unprecedented growth over the past decade, transforming from a niche market into a multi-billion dollar ecosystem that connects millions of people worldwide. This explosive expansion has created significant opportunities for entrepreneurs and developers who recognize the potential of digital romance platforms. The complexity of modern dating applications, however, presents substantial challenges for those looking to enter this competitive market without extensive development resources and time investments.

Online dating app templates have emerged as powerful solutions that enable entrepreneurs to launch sophisticated dating platforms without the traditional barriers of custom development. These templates provide comprehensive foundations that incorporate years of user experience research, technical optimization, and industry best practices into ready-to-deploy solutions. The strategic advantage of using proven templates extends beyond mere cost savings to encompass accelerated time-to-market, reduced technical risks, and access to features that would typically require months of specialized development.

The modern dating app landscape demands sophisticated functionality that balances user engagement with privacy protection, seamless communication with monetization opportunities, and innovative matching algorithms with intuitive user interfaces. Successful dating platforms must navigate complex technical requirements including real-time messaging, location-based services, photo processing, and secure payment systems while maintaining the performance standards that users expect from contemporary mobile applications.

The competitive nature of the dating app market requires new entrants to launch with professional-grade features and polished user experiences that can compete with established platforms. Online dating app templates provide access to these enterprise-level capabilities while maintaining the flexibility needed to create unique brand identities and serve specialized market segments. For entrepreneurs seeking comprehensive development solutions that extend beyond basic templates, platforms like ShipOneDay offer complete SaaS starter kits with advanced features specifically designed for modern application development.

Understanding the architecture and implementation strategies behind successful online dating app templates becomes crucial for entrepreneurs who want to make informed decisions about their platform development approach. These templates represent more than design frameworks; they embody strategic business decisions that influence user acquisition, engagement patterns, and ultimately, platform profitability and sustainability in the competitive dating market.

Understanding Online Dating App Templates

The evolution of online dating platforms reflects broader technological advances and changing social behaviors that have shaped how people form romantic connections in the digital age. Early dating websites relied on simple profile matching and basic messaging systems, but modern dating app templates incorporate sophisticated algorithms, real-time communication, and social networking features that create comprehensive relationship-building ecosystems. This evolution has been driven by user expectations for seamless mobile experiences, instant gratification, and personalized matching that adapts to individual preferences and behaviors.

Contemporary online dating app templates are built on foundations of mobile-first design principles that prioritize touch interfaces, gesture-based navigation, and optimized performance across diverse device specifications. These templates recognize that dating apps are primarily mobile experiences where users expect immediate responsiveness, intuitive interactions, and visually appealing interfaces that encourage prolonged engagement. The mobile-centric approach influences every aspect of template design, from simplified onboarding processes to streamlined messaging interfaces that facilitate natural conversation flow.

The psychological aspects of dating app design play crucial roles in template architecture, with successful templates incorporating elements that build trust, encourage authentic self-presentation, and create positive user experiences that lead to meaningful connections. These psychological considerations manifest in design choices like profile layout structures, photo presentation systems, and interaction mechanisms that feel natural and non-intimidating to users who may be hesitant about online dating. The most effective templates balance the excitement of discovery with the comfort of privacy controls and safety features.

User experience optimization in modern dating app templates extends beyond visual design to encompass comprehensive user journey mapping that considers different user types, relationship goals, and engagement patterns. These templates provide flexible frameworks that can accommodate various dating styles, from casual encounters to serious relationship seeking, while maintaining consistent usability standards. The user experience considerations include onboarding optimization that minimizes friction while gathering necessary information, matching interface design that makes decision-making intuitive, and communication tools that facilitate natural relationship progression.

Technical architecture underlying modern dating app templates reflects the complex requirements of real-time applications that must handle simultaneous user interactions, location processing, media uploads, and secure data transmission. These templates incorporate scalable backend systems that can grow with user bases while maintaining performance standards, content delivery networks that ensure fast media loading, and security protocols that protect sensitive personal information. The technical sophistication of modern templates enables features that were previously available only to well-funded development teams.

The business model integration within dating app templates demonstrates understanding of the various monetization strategies that successful dating platforms employ. These templates include subscription management systems, in-app purchase frameworks, and advertising integration capabilities that provide multiple revenue streams while maintaining positive user experiences. The monetization features are designed to feel natural within the user experience rather than intrusive, supporting long-term user retention and platform sustainability.

Essential Features of Dating App Templates

User registration and profile creation systems in modern dating app templates represent sophisticated onboarding experiences that balance information gathering with user engagement optimization. These systems typically offer multiple registration options including social media integration, phone number verification, and email-based accounts that accommodate different user preferences while maintaining security standards. The profile creation process guides users through comprehensive self-presentation that includes photo uploads, personal information, interests, and relationship preferences while providing privacy controls that allow users to manage their visibility and information sharing.

The matching algorithms integrated into professional dating app templates employ various methodologies ranging from location-based discovery to compatibility scoring systems that analyze user preferences, behaviors, and interaction patterns. These algorithms continuously learn from user feedback through like/dislike actions, message responses, and profile engagement metrics to improve match quality over time. Advanced templates include customizable matching parameters that allow users to adjust their discovery preferences while providing platform administrators with tools to fine-tune algorithm performance based on user satisfaction metrics.

Real-time messaging and communication systems represent critical components of dating app templates that enable users to build relationships through various interaction methods. These systems typically include text messaging with emoji support, photo and video sharing capabilities, voice messages, and video calling features that provide comprehensive communication options. The messaging architecture ensures reliable message delivery, read receipts, and typing indicators while implementing privacy features like message expiration, screenshot notifications, and blocking capabilities that protect user safety.

Modern dating app interface design

Location-based services and proximity matching functionality enable users to discover potential matches within their geographic area while providing privacy controls that protect exact location information. These features typically include distance-based filtering, location update management, and travel mode options that accommodate users who move frequently or want to connect with people in different cities. The location services are designed to enhance matching relevance while respecting user privacy through approximate location sharing and opt-out capabilities.

Safety and privacy features in professional dating app templates address the unique security concerns associated with online dating through comprehensive protection systems. These features include identity verification options, photo verification processes, background check integrations, and reporting mechanisms that help maintain platform safety. The privacy controls enable users to manage their visibility, control information sharing, and block unwanted interactions while providing platform administrators with tools to investigate reports and maintain community standards.

Subscription management and monetization systems integrated into dating app templates provide flexible frameworks for implementing various business models including freemium subscriptions, premium features, and virtual gift systems. These systems handle payment processing, subscription renewals, and feature access control while providing users with clear value propositions for premium services. The monetization features are designed to enhance rather than restrict the core dating experience, encouraging upgrades through additional functionality rather than artificial limitations.

Social networking and community features in advanced dating app templates extend beyond basic matching to create comprehensive platforms that support various relationship-building activities. These features might include group events, interest-based communities, dating advice content, and social sharing capabilities that encourage user engagement beyond individual conversations. The community features help create platform loyalty while providing additional opportunities for users to connect and interact in various contexts.

Design Principles for Modern Dating Apps

Visual design principles in contemporary dating app templates prioritize creating emotional connections through carefully crafted aesthetic choices that evoke feelings of excitement, trust, and authenticity. The color palettes typically employ warm, inviting tones that create comfortable environments while using accent colors strategically to highlight important actions and create visual hierarchy. Typography choices balance readability with personality, often incorporating modern sans-serif fonts that feel approachable yet sophisticated, supporting the overall brand experience while ensuring accessibility across different user demographics.

The psychology of dating app interface design influences user behavior through subtle design elements that encourage positive interactions and meaningful connections. Successful templates incorporate principles of behavioral psychology through features like gradual information revelation that builds anticipation, positive reinforcement through matching celebrations, and social proof elements that demonstrate platform activity and success stories. These psychological considerations extend to interaction design patterns that feel rewarding and encourage continued engagement without creating addictive behaviors that might harm user wellbeing.

Mobile-first design approaches in modern dating app templates recognize that the vast majority of users access dating platforms through smartphones, requiring interface designs that optimize for touch interactions and limited screen real estate. These designs prioritize essential functionality while minimizing cognitive load through simplified navigation structures, clear visual hierarchies, and intuitive gesture-based controls. The mobile optimization includes considerations for various screen sizes, operating systems, and device capabilities while maintaining consistent user experiences across platforms.

User interface elements in professional dating app templates are designed to facilitate natural interaction patterns that mirror real-world social behaviors. The swipe-based matching interfaces, for example, provide immediate feedback and clear decision-making mechanisms that feel intuitive and engaging. Profile presentation layouts balance comprehensive information display with visual appeal, using card-based designs, progressive disclosure, and interactive elements that encourage exploration while preventing information overwhelm.

Accessibility considerations in modern dating app templates ensure that platforms remain usable by individuals with various abilities and technical limitations. These considerations include support for screen readers, keyboard navigation, high contrast modes, and font size adjustments that make dating apps inclusive for users with visual, motor, or cognitive disabilities. The accessibility features are integrated seamlessly into the overall design rather than added as afterthoughts, creating better experiences for all users while expanding potential market reach.

Brand expression capabilities within dating app templates provide flexibility for creating unique visual identities while maintaining usability standards and user experience consistency. These capabilities typically include customizable color schemes, typography options, logo integration, and layout variations that allow dating platforms to differentiate themselves in competitive markets. The brand customization options are designed to work within proven user experience frameworks, ensuring that visual uniqueness doesn't compromise functionality or user satisfaction.

Technical Architecture and Development Considerations

Backend infrastructure requirements for modern dating apps demand robust, scalable systems capable of handling real-time interactions, large media files, and complex matching algorithms while maintaining fast response times and high availability. Professional dating app templates incorporate cloud-based architectures that can scale automatically based on user demand, distributed database systems that ensure data consistency and availability, and content delivery networks that optimize media loading speeds globally. These infrastructure considerations are essential for supporting the intensive computational requirements of matching algorithms and the bandwidth demands of photo and video sharing.

Real-time messaging implementation in dating app templates requires sophisticated WebSocket connections, message queuing systems, and push notification services that ensure reliable communication between users regardless of their online status or device capabilities. The messaging architecture must handle message delivery confirmation, offline message storage, and multi-device synchronization while maintaining encryption standards that protect private conversations. Advanced templates include features like typing indicators, read receipts, and message status updates that create natural communication experiences similar to popular messaging platforms.

Photo and media handling capabilities represent critical technical components that significantly impact user experience and platform performance. Modern dating app templates include automated image processing systems that optimize photos for different display contexts, implement content moderation through AI-powered analysis, and provide users with editing tools that enhance their profile presentations. The media handling systems must balance image quality with loading performance while implementing security measures that prevent inappropriate content and protect user privacy.

Dating app technical architecture

Database design and data management strategies in professional dating app templates accommodate the complex relationships between users, matches, messages, and behavioral data while ensuring fast query performance and data integrity. These systems typically employ both relational databases for structured data like user profiles and NoSQL databases for flexible data like user preferences and interaction logs. The database architecture includes indexing strategies that optimize matching algorithm performance and data partitioning approaches that maintain performance as user bases grow.

Security implementation throughout dating app templates addresses the unique vulnerabilities associated with personal information sharing and relationship building through comprehensive protection measures. These security features include end-to-end encryption for private communications, secure authentication systems that prevent unauthorized access, and data protection protocols that comply with privacy regulations like GDPR. The security architecture also includes fraud detection systems that identify fake profiles and suspicious behaviors while protecting legitimate users from harassment and abuse.

API design and integration capabilities in modern dating app templates provide flexible frameworks for connecting with third-party services like social media platforms, payment processors, and analytics tools. These APIs enable features like social media profile importing, subscription payment processing, and detailed user behavior tracking while maintaining security standards and user privacy controls. The API architecture supports both internal platform functionality and potential future integrations with emerging technologies or business partnerships.

Performance optimization strategies embedded in dating app templates ensure smooth user experiences even under high load conditions through various technical approaches including code optimization, database query efficiency, and resource management. These optimizations include lazy loading for profile images, efficient matching algorithm implementation, and caching strategies that reduce server load while maintaining real-time functionality. The performance considerations extend to mobile app optimization that minimizes battery usage and data consumption while providing rich interactive experiences.

Monetization Strategies and Business Models

Freemium subscription models in dating app templates provide strategic frameworks for balancing free functionality with premium features that encourage user upgrades while maintaining large active user bases. These models typically offer core matching and messaging features at no cost while reserving advanced capabilities like unlimited likes, premium filters, and enhanced visibility for paying subscribers. The freemium approach creates natural upgrade paths that demonstrate value before requiring payment, leading to higher conversion rates and user satisfaction compared to purely paid models.

Premium subscription tiers in professional dating app templates often include multiple levels of paid access that cater to different user needs and spending capabilities. These tiers might range from basic premium features like ad removal and extended matching range to advanced options including priority customer support, exclusive events access, and enhanced profile analytics. The tiered approach maximizes revenue potential by capturing users with varying willingness to pay while providing clear value propositions for each subscription level.

In-app purchase systems integrated into dating app templates enable additional revenue streams through virtual gifts, profile boosts, and special features that users can purchase individually rather than through ongoing subscriptions. These purchase options provide flexibility for users who prefer pay-per-use models while creating opportunities for impulse purchases during high-engagement moments like receiving matches or planning dates. The in-app purchase systems are designed to feel natural within the user experience rather than disruptive or manipulative.

Advertising integration capabilities in modern dating app templates provide alternative monetization options that can supplement or replace subscription revenue while maintaining positive user experiences. These advertising systems typically include native ad formats that blend seamlessly with profile browsing, sponsored profile promotions that highlight local businesses or events, and partnership opportunities with relevant brands in lifestyle, entertainment, or relationship categories. The advertising implementation includes targeting capabilities that ensure relevance while respecting user privacy preferences.

User acquisition and retention strategies built into dating app templates recognize that sustainable profitability depends on both attracting new users and maintaining engagement among existing users. These strategies include referral systems that reward users for inviting friends, gamification elements that encourage regular platform usage, and personalized communication campaigns that re-engage inactive users. The retention features are designed to create genuine value for users rather than artificial engagement through addictive mechanics.

Analytics and performance tracking systems in professional dating app templates provide comprehensive insights into user behavior, platform performance, and business metrics that inform optimization decisions and strategic planning. These analytics systems track key performance indicators like user acquisition costs, lifetime value, engagement rates, and conversion metrics while providing detailed insights into matching success rates and user satisfaction levels. The analytics capabilities enable data-driven decision making that supports both user experience improvements and business growth objectives.

Revenue optimization features in advanced dating app templates include dynamic pricing systems that adjust subscription costs based on market conditions, A/B testing frameworks that optimize conversion flows, and predictive analytics that identify users most likely to upgrade to premium services. These optimization systems help maximize revenue potential while maintaining fair pricing and positive user experiences that support long-term platform sustainability.

The ShipOneDay Advantage for Dating App Development

While traditional online dating app templates provide basic functionality and design frameworks, comprehensive development platforms like ShipOneDay offer enterprise-grade solutions that address the full spectrum of requirements for launching successful dating applications. ShipOneDay's production-ready Next.js 15 SaaS starter kit provides sophisticated infrastructure that supports the complex technical demands of modern dating platforms while maintaining the flexibility needed for customization and brand differentiation.

The user management and authentication systems built into ShipOneDay surpass typical template offerings through enterprise-grade security features, multi-factor authentication options, and comprehensive user profile management capabilities that dating platforms require. These systems include advanced privacy controls, identity verification frameworks, and user behavior tracking that enable dating apps to maintain safe environments while providing detailed insights into user engagement patterns. The authentication architecture supports various login methods including social media integration while maintaining security standards that protect sensitive personal information.

Real-time infrastructure capabilities in ShipOneDay provide the robust foundation necessary for dating app features like instant messaging, live notifications, and dynamic matching updates that users expect from modern platforms. The real-time systems are built on scalable WebSocket implementations that handle thousands of concurrent connections while maintaining low latency and high reliability. This infrastructure enables advanced features like typing indicators, read receipts, and instant match notifications that create engaging user experiences without requiring custom backend development.

The comprehensive admin dashboard included in ShipOneDay offers dating app operators powerful tools for platform management, user moderation, and business analytics that go far beyond basic template administration interfaces. These administrative capabilities include user behavior monitoring, content moderation workflows, subscription management, and detailed reporting systems that enable effective platform governance. The admin tools are designed specifically for the unique challenges of dating platform management including safety monitoring, fake profile detection, and user engagement optimization.

Subscription management and billing integration in ShipOneDay provides sophisticated e-commerce capabilities that support various dating app monetization strategies including tiered subscriptions, in-app purchases, and promotional campaigns. The billing systems handle complex scenarios like subscription upgrades, refunds, and international payments while providing users with transparent pricing and easy subscription management. These capabilities eliminate the need for custom payment system development while ensuring compliance with financial regulations and industry standards.

AI content generation and optimization features integrated into ShipOneDay can enhance dating platforms through automated content moderation, personalized matching suggestions, and intelligent conversation starters that improve user engagement. These AI capabilities can analyze user preferences and behaviors to optimize matching algorithms, generate personalized content recommendations, and provide insights that help dating platforms improve user satisfaction and retention rates.

The perfect Lighthouse scores achieved by ShipOneDay applications ensure that dating platforms built on this foundation provide exceptional user experiences through fast loading times, smooth interactions, and optimal mobile performance. These performance characteristics are crucial for dating apps where user engagement depends heavily on seamless experiences and immediate responsiveness. The performance optimization includes image optimization, code splitting, and caching strategies that maintain speed even with high-resolution photos and real-time features.

Conclusion

The online dating industry continues to evolve with technological advances and changing social behaviors that create new opportunities for innovative platforms and specialized communities. Entrepreneurs entering this market face the choice between building custom solutions from scratch or leveraging proven templates and comprehensive development platforms that accelerate time-to-market while ensuring professional quality and scalability.

Online dating app templates provide valuable foundations for platform development, offering pre-built functionality and design patterns that address common requirements while reducing development costs and technical risks. The most successful dating platforms, however, require sophisticated features, robust infrastructure, and ongoing optimization that extend beyond basic template capabilities.

For entrepreneurs serious about creating competitive dating platforms that can scale and succeed in today's market, comprehensive development solutions like ShipOneDay offer significant advantages over traditional templates. The combination of enterprise-grade features, modern technology stack, and production-ready infrastructure provides the foundation needed for building dating applications that can compete with established platforms while maintaining the flexibility for unique positioning and specialized market focus.

The future of online dating will likely include increased personalization through artificial intelligence, enhanced safety features through advanced verification systems, and new interaction models that blend digital and physical relationship building. Platforms built on scalable, modern foundations will be best positioned to adapt to these evolving trends while maintaining the performance and user experience standards that determine success in the competitive dating market.

Recommended Reading

Discover more insights from our latest articles

Boilerplate Templates: Accelerate Your SaaS Development in 2025
Development Tips

Boilerplate Templates: Accelerate Your SaaS Development in 2025

Discover how modern boilerplate templates are transforming SaaS development in 2025. Learn to leverage these powerful tools for faster, more efficient project delivery.

7 min read
Read more
Troubleshooting Custom Config Template Card in Home Assistant: Complete Guide
Development Tips

Troubleshooting Custom Config Template Card in Home Assistant: Complete Guide

Learn how to effectively troubleshoot and fix common issues with the custom:config-template-card in Home Assistant, including configuration tips and best practices.

3 min read
Read more
Building a Loan Tracking Platform with Next.js and Notion
Development Tips

Building a Loan Tracking Platform with Next.js and Notion

Learn how to create a powerful loan management system using Next.js and Notion API. Perfect for developers building financial management solutions.

4 min read
Read more